Convenience **Remote Engine Start will only operate for a total runtime of 20 minutes before the vehicle will need to be manually restarted from within the vehicle. (Example: 5 Minute + 5 Minute + 10 Minute = 20 minute total runtime) Please remember to comply with your local municipal by-law regarding the control of motor vehicle idling. An "Engine Stop" button will display, once your vehicle’s engine has successfully started. If you choose to stop your vehicle, press the "Engine Stop" button and enter your STARLINK PIN to send the command. NOTE This feature will not work under the following conditions: • Ignition is ACC or ON • Vehicle is moving • Any vehicle door / engine hood / tailgate or trunk is ajar • If your vehicle has not been started for 14 days • Weak signal area NOTE Depending on how your vehicle is equipped, some features might not be available. Your vehicle will need to be equipped with the following for Remote Engine Start: • Keyless Access with Push-Button Start • Lineartronic ® CVT Remote Engine Start with Climate Control: • Automatic Climate Control Check with your authorized dealer or MySubaru to see what SUBARU STARLINK ® Connected Services features are applicable to your vehicle. NOTE Remote Engine Start with Climate Control is only applicable to gas engine vehicles. This feature is not applicable to the Crosstrek Plug-in Hybrid. 25
